while当满足条件则进入循环体while condition:block例:flag为真值,则为条件满足,当flag直接为0的时候则为假,则不满足while判断如果是负数也为真,因为只有0为假打印结果如下:for循环不做多介绍,for循环则是在一个可迭代的对象中进行迭代循环每一次将集合中筛取,这个集合可能是顺序的 可能不是顺序的,但是每一次都是不同的range步长首先来看一下步长的含义pytho
转载
2024-09-05 16:14:34
45阅读
我们今天的话题要从“可变对象的原处修改”这里引入,这是一个值得注意的问题。上一集里我们谈到,赋值操作总是存储对象的引用,而不是这些对象的拷贝。由于在这个过程中赋值操作会产生相同对象的多个引用,因此我们需要意识到“可变对象”在这里可能存在的问题:在原处修改可变对象可能会影响程序中其他引用该对象的变量。如果你不想看到这种情景,则你需要明确的拷贝一个对象,而不是简单赋值。X = [1,2,3,4,5]
# JavaBean初始化赋值
JavaBean是Java语言中一种特殊的类,用于封装数据,并提供对数据的访问方法。在Java中,通常我们需要对JavaBean进行初始化赋值,以便在程序运行过程中能够正确地使用这些数据。本文将介绍JavaBean的初始化赋值的方法,并提供代码示例。
## JavaBean初始化赋值方法
JavaBean的初始化赋值通常有以下几种方法:
1. 使用构造方法进
原创
2024-04-03 04:10:14
50阅读
以直接量的方式描述对象的初始化过程的表达式。它是用花括号括起来的由零或者多对属性名 / 关联值组成的列表,值不需要是直接量,每次对象初始化被执行到时他们会执行一次。语法: ObjectLiteral :
{ }
{ PropertyNameAndValueList }
{ PropertyNameAndValueList , }
1.初始化在C++中,初始化与赋值操作是完全不同的两个操作。初始化不是赋值,初始化的含义是创建变量时赋予其一个初始值,而赋值的含义是把对象的当前值擦除,而以一个新值来代替。初始化的方式有: 1 int test = 0;
2 int test = {0};
3 int test{0};
4 int test(0); 第3行这种使用花括号初始化的方式被称为列表初始化(C++11新
转载
2024-05-18 23:04:17
49阅读
文章标题一、总结对属性赋值的先后顺序二、JavaBean(了解)三、UML类图(了解) 一、总结对属性赋值的先后顺序① 默认初始化 ② 显式初始化(即在定义中就已对变量赋值) ③ 构造器中初始化 ④ 通过“对象.属性“或“对象.方法”的方式赋值(主要看“后面”)二、JavaBean(了解)JavaBean是一种Java语言写成的可重用组件。所谓javaBean,是指符合如下标准的Java类:类是
转载
2023-08-18 07:36:53
88阅读
# Python多个变量初始化赋值的实现方法
## 引言
在Python编程中,经常会遇到需要同时给多个变量赋值的情况。为了帮助刚入行的小白理解如何实现Python多个变量的初始化赋值,本文将为你详细介绍整个过程,并提供相应的代码和注释说明。
## 流程概述
实现Python多个变量初始化赋值的流程如下:
1. 定义多个变量;
2. 使用赋值操作符将值赋给这些变量。
下面将详细介绍每一
原创
2023-11-09 16:23:33
180阅读
# Python 字典初始化及赋值
在 Python 中,字典是一种非常重要而常用的数据结构。字典以键值对(key-value pairs)的形式存储数据,允许我们使用唯一的键来访问对应的值。本文将详细介绍如何初始化和赋值 Python 字典,并通过代码示例帮助读者更好地理解这一概念。
## 字典的初始化
在 Python 中,我们可以通过多种方式初始化字典。最常用的方法是使用大括号 `{}
原创
2024-08-13 09:24:38
167阅读
# 初始化数组并赋值的Python实现方法
作为一名经验丰富的开发者,我将会向你介绍如何在Python中初始化数组并进行赋值操作。这对于刚入行的小白来说可能是一个比较基础和重要的知识点,让我们一起来学习吧。
## 流程图
```mermaid
flowchart TD
A(开始) --> B(初始化数组)
B --> C(赋值操作)
C --> D(结束)
```
原创
2024-04-13 07:01:27
43阅读
初始化:当对象在创建时获得了一个特定的值,我们说这个对象被初始化(initialized)了。用于初始化对象的值可以是任意复杂的表达式。当一次定义了两个或多个对象时,对象的名字随着定义也就马上可以被使用了。因此,在同一条定义语句中,可以用先定义的变量值去初始化后定义的其他变量;//正确:price先被初始化,随后别用于初始化discount
double price=100.33,discount
转载
2023-12-09 21:36:36
30阅读
本章主要讲解HashMap初始化,根据源码,我们可以知道HashMap初始化主要有4个构造方法,接下来就具体来了解下它的4个构造方法:一、无参构造方法/**
* Constructs an empty <tt>HashMap</tt> with the default initial capacity
* (16) and the default loa
转载
2023-12-21 10:49:49
66阅读
1. 默认validate参数的初始化: 这个插件如果要用,肯定很多页面都会用到,毕竟如果有表单,就需要验证。而且这个插件的默认语言是英语,所以我们要转换成汉语。我们当然不希望在每个页面的js都写一遍message。所以我们可以在公用的js里面对默认message进行初始化。 1. jQuery.extend(jQuery.validator.messages,{
转载
2023-08-24 10:50:21
116阅读
单向链表定义
单向链表(Single Linked List)也叫单链表,是一种链式存取的数据结构,用一组地址任意的存储单元存放线性表中的数据元素,是链表中最简单的一种形式。链表中的数据是以结点来表示的,每个节点包含两个域,一个元素域(数据元素的映象)和一个链接域,链接指向链表中的下一个节点,而最后一个节点的链接域则指向一个空值。
节点示意图 单向链表示意图
创建列表sample_list = ['a',1,('a','b')]Python 列表操作sample_list = ['a','b',0,1,3]得到列表中的某一个值value_start = sample_list[0]end_value = sample_list[-1]删除列表的第一个值del sample_list[0]在列表中插入一个值sample_list[0:0] =
转载
2024-09-14 16:28:42
18阅读
拷贝初始化是初始化变量的一种方式:用等号=来初始化变量 这种方式让人误以为初始化是赋值的一种,其实不然,初始化不是赋值 初始化:创建变量时赋予其一个初始值 赋值:把对象的当前值擦除,而以一个新值来替代
转载
2018-03-24 08:34:00
98阅读
# 类初始化赋值在Java中的应用
Java是一门面向对象的编程语言,类是Java中的一个重要概念。在实际编程中,我们经常需要对类的属性进行初始化赋值。本文将深入探讨Java中的类初始化赋值概念,通过示例代码和类图帮助大家更好地理解这一主题。
## 一、类的基础知识
在Java中,类是一种模板,定义了对象的属性和行为。类的基本结构如下所示:
```java
public class Car
# Java ListBean 初始化赋值
在Java编程中,`List`是一个非常常用的集合类型,用于存储有序的元素。特别是在处理对象集合时,使用`List`可以方便地管理和操作这些对象。本文将重点讨论如何使用Java中的ListBean进行初始化和赋值,通过示例代码来展示这一过程。
## 什么是ListBean?
`ListBean`通常是用于表示含有多个属性的Java Bean,特别是
原创
2024-08-25 06:10:39
48阅读
## Java初始化赋值字典
在Java编程中,经常会用到字典(Dictionary)这种数据结构,它允许我们存储键值对,并可以通过键来快速检索值。在使用字典之前,我们需要对其进行初始化和赋值。本文将介绍如何在Java中初始化和赋值字典,以及一些常见的用法和技巧。
### 什么是字典
字典是一种键值对的数据结构,也被称为映射(Map)。在Java中,常用的字典实现类包括HashMap、Tre
原创
2024-05-13 06:39:54
216阅读
# Java中的set初始化赋值
## 引言
在Java开发中,我们经常会遇到需要给set进行初始化赋值的情况。set是一种存储不重复元素的集合,它是基于哈希表实现的。在本篇文章中,我将向你介绍如何在Java中实现set的初始化赋值。
## 流程概述
下面是一个简单的流程图,展示了set初始化赋值的步骤。
```mermaid
flowchart TD
A[创建一个空的set对象]
原创
2024-01-24 11:03:31
147阅读
# 教你如何实现“jquery file 初始化赋值”
## 一、整体流程:
```mermaid
flowchart TD
A[开始] --> B[引入jQuery和file插件]
B --> C[创建HTML结构]
C --> D[初始化file插件]
D --> E[获取文件列表]
E --> F[赋值给input或其他元素]
F -->
原创
2024-05-09 06:51:23
62阅读